FitMoney $uperSquad is a gamified digital learning platform designed to make financial literacy fun and accessible for students aged K-6. This innovative resource is free to use and aims to fill gaps left by traditional education by building strong financial habits early in life.
Key Features of FitMoney $uperSquad
Modular Curriculum
The FitMoney $uperSquad curriculum is divided into 12 modules, each designed for digestible and progressive learning of financial literacy. Subjects covered include money, valuing it, counting, credit, saving, budgeting, insurance, taxes, and investing.
Game-Based Learning
FitMoney $uperSquad uses interactive, game-like activities to teach concepts, making the experience enjoyable and accessible for students of different ages and learning styles. Students progress through the modules, earning coins and certificates as they go.
Flexible Implementation
FitMoney $uperSquad can be used both in classrooms and individually by students at home. Supplementary materials for educators and caregivers are provided to support learning regardless of the child's environment.
Focus on Practical Financial Skills
FitMoney $uperSquad emphasises real-world money skills such as saving, spending, and investing, aiming to prepare students for better financial decision-making later in life.
Support for Educators and Families
In addition to resources designed for students, FitMoney $uperSquad offers resources for teachers and caregivers to create a collaborative learning experience. The New Teacher Starter Kit and Best Tools for Teachers are just a few examples of the resources available.
To start, have students work their way through appropriate modules before working as a class on what was learned. As an alternative, present the videos to the class and work through the games as a team.
For further learning, FitMoney $uperSquad offers suggestions for extending the learning. Consider supplementing learning by using real-world experiences to help students see finances in action.
FitMoney $uperSquad does not require personal information, charges, or advertisements. It is free for all students, and the company accepts donations as part of its mission to offer these learnings for free.
